Greetings, I just replaced a 120W panel with a new 130W panel via a warranty. 130W was all the manufacturer had. When I hooked the system back up, my charge controller read 0.00. The second I removed the new panel, it went back up to normal of around 20.3. That is the mystery. Here are some facts.

The solar system is 24V. The 120 and 130W panels are 12V wired in series. I get plenty of voltage at the junction box on the back of each panel, and I get a bit more down at the junction box where the panels are linked to the other panels in the array so I know I don’t have a break in the line somewhere.

I double checked the run of the wiring, and all is as it should be based on the manufacturers recommendations and how the system was set up previously.

Obviously you need more information to help me troubleshoot this, so what is it that you need to know?

The system is NOT grid tied, and powers my cabin.
Thanks for all your help. - Shane

RE: Solar Panel Mega Mystery (need a sherlock!)

IT really, REALLY,  R E A L L Y  sounds like you hooked the new one up backwards.  That is exactly what would happen.  Check your panel's open circuit and make sure you're wiring the + to the - of the next panel.

Another possibility is that the new panel is open circuited.
Defective units DO get shipped in new boxes.

How do I check if the new shipped panel is open circuit?

RE: Solar Panel Mega Mystery (need a sherlock!)

All you need to do is unhook the panel (one terminal) and if there's any light on it at all - measure a volt or two. It can't put out a voltage if it's open circuit.

As Keith says. But you should also put some load, an incandescent lamp for instance, across the voltmeter. An open panel may not be completely open - just having a high internal resistance. So a voltmeter will show a voltage if used alone.
